Plunge, or In-feed grinding is a method of centerless grinding that has been used by operators in grinding relatively complex parts. Unlike the through-feed grinding process which pulls the workpiece past the grinding wheels, the workpiece in in-feed is held and supported between the wheels for a thorough grinding even in the smallest part ...

In centerless grinding, the workpiece is held between two grinding wheels, rotating in the same direction at different speeds.One grinding wheel is on a fixed axis and rotates so that the force applied to the workpiece is directed downward. This wheel usually performs the grinding action by having a higher linear speed than the workpiece at the point of contact.

Centerless grinding is the process of removing material from the outer diameter of a workpiece using a grinding wheel. The workpiece is located on its outer diameter and supported by a working blade located between the adjusting wheel and the grinding wheel. The adjustment wheel drives the machined parts, and the grinding wheel removes material.
